סיכום:This text provides an enjoyable introduction to quantitative biology for students in the biological sciences and explains important techniques and analytical methods in the context of the student's aim: to answer biological questions as clearly as possible. The authors introduce the various stages in the process of enquiry, starting with unstructured observation and working through to the production of a complete written report. Logical steps guide the student through each stage of the enquiry to the point where he or she will be able to carry out an open-ended project as well as cope with more structured practical work.
